Washington (AP) – with an advance from the President Donald TrumpHouse Republicans sent A GOP budget blueprint To adopt a step on Tuesday to his “big, beautiful bill” with 4.5 trillion dollars of tax reliefs and spending cuts in the amount of US 2 trillion Opposition of Democrats And discomfort among Republicans.

Spokesman Mike Johnson Almost no voices had to save in his Bare-Bones Gop majority And fought on all fronts against Democrats, uncomfortable ranking and skeptical gop senator-to drive the party’s signature package forward. Trump called at Wayward GOP legislator and invited the Republicans to the White House.

The vote was 217-215, with all Democrats lying against the Democrats, and the result was in danger until the hammer.

“With such a vote, you will always have people with whom you speak until the end of the vote,” said majority leader Steve Scalisue before the roller call. “It’s so tight.”

The government’s covering is not always popular at home

Even if they progress, the Republicans met with a familiar problem: the performance of the federal expenses is usually easier to say than done. With cuts of the Pentagon and other programs that are largely restricted, a huge part of the other state expenditure opts for health care, food brands, student loans and programs on which their voters are based.

Several Republican legislators fear that the scope of the cuts in the eyes – in particular about 880 billion US dollars to the committee that takes over the health expenditure, including medicaid, or 230 billion US dollars to the agricultural committee, the food brand – will be too harmful to their voters at home.

GOP leaders insist that Medicaid is not listed in the first 60-page budget framework, which is correct. Johnson and his management team also informed the legislator that they would have enough time to discuss the details if they shape the final package.

However, legislators wanted assurances, the health program and others are protected because the plans are developed in the coming weeks and summarized with the Senate.

Rep. Mike LawlerRn.Y., said Trump, he promised that he would not allow Medicaid to be cut.

“The president was clear about it. I was clear that Lawler said.

At the same time, GOP -Deficit falcons hold support until they are convinced Nation’s debt load 36 trillion dollars. They warn that it is stacking on debts because the costs for the tax breaks -at least 4.5 trillion dollars over the course of the decade, the spending cuts of 2 trillion dollars for government programs outweigh.

The GOP house is facing pitfalls

Johnson, whose party lost seats In the elections of the last November commands One of the thinnest majorities In current history, which means that he has to keep almost every Republican in line or risk losing the vote.

The budget is compiled during a lengthy process that first sends instructions to the various committees of the house and the Senate, in which there are several weeks to create more detailed plans for additional debates and voices.

MP Jodey Arrington, the Republican Chairman of the Budget Committee for the Budget Budget, said with assumptions of economic growth of 1.8%, as was projected by the impartial Congress Budget to 2.6%, as was projected by the Republicans of the House that the package would be generated and secured for over 10 years, and secured, that the plan reduces the deficit.

Some fiscal interest groups consider the economic projections of the GOP to be overly bullish.
